Cadillac suddenly axes Lowdon, Budkowski takes over
Image via grandprix.comCadillac has made a surprising decision to replace Graeme Lowdon with Marcin Budkowski as team principal during the summer break. CEO Dan Towriss took full responsibility for the change, clarifying that it was not a mutual decision and highlighting the necessity for confidentiality in such appointments within Formula 1. Budkowski, who has a history in the sport, expressed enthusiasm for leading a project he believes in, supported by significant resources from General Motors and TWG Group.
The management shift has raised speculation about further changes within Cadillac's leadership. Ralf Schumacher, a former F1 driver, indicated that this might be just the beginning of a series of adjustments as the team seeks to enhance its competitive edge in the sport.
